Summer Reading Program: Summer is a busy time
for many of our libraries and this year is no different; reports are coming in
that they are having successful summer
reading programs. Some are reporting record numbers of
participants. Special thanks to the
Division for Libraries, Technology, and Community Learning for providing passes
for the Bristol Renaissance Faire and the “Wisconsin Castles” (historic house
museums) promotion.
2006 County
Funding: As of
this writing, funding requests have been sent to the committees overseeing
libraries in Green Lake & Waushara counties and requests will be going out in
Fond du Lac and Marquette counties
soon. It’s too early in the county
budget process to tell how funding will be next year, but we’re expecting
another tight budget season.
WCTS Collection
Enhancement Grant: The
effects of the WCTS Collection Enhancement
grants continue to be seen in libraries in Marquette,
Green Lake,
& Waushara Counties. As of the end of June about 3,100 items have
been purchased under this year’s grant.
Library Director Changes: Erika Pawinski will
start as director of the Oxford Public Library on 1 August; current director Ardis Kuhlman will be staying on until mid-August to help
with the transition. Endeavor Public
Library has advertised for a new director and will probably be interviewing in
late July or early August.
